#1....why the heck is my car so much louder in reverse? ever since i got my cat and stuff done my car has this nice rumbly growl, and you can actually feel the car vibrating a little bit if you get on it hard in reverse.....doesnt do the same thing in any forward gear no matter how hard you get on it....so im thinking something...is hitting something in reverse that it wouldnt hit in drive, but why?

#2 upon removing the oil cap from my running engine, it stumbles and the idle becomes rough, this is a symptom of a bad PCV valve correct?

#3 my gas mileage has been suffering a bit lately, the car runs very well, im thinkin maybe the O2 sensor is crapping out, but just isnt throwing a code, also the PCV valve in #2 could be causing problems, i think the plugs are fine, what are some other things that could cause bad gas mileage?
